Core Points - The document outlines the governance structure and operational guidelines for the senior management of Shenzhen Shiyida Technology Co., Ltd, focusing on the role and responsibilities of the Chief Executive Officer (CEO) [1][2][3] Group 1: CEO Qualifications and Appointment Procedures - The CEO must possess extensive economic and management knowledge, practical experience, and strong comprehensive management abilities [6] - The appointment of the CEO is proposed by the Chairman and requires approval from the Board of Directors [3][4] - Specific disqualifications for the CEO include criminal convictions related to corruption, bankruptcy responsibilities, and being listed as a dishonest executor by the court [2][5] Group 2: CEO Powers and Responsibilities - The CEO is responsible for managing the company's operations, implementing board resolutions, and reporting to the board [13][20] - The CEO has the authority to make decisions on asset disposals and investments based on the company's audited net assets [19] - The CEO must ensure the authenticity of reports regarding major contracts and financial conditions to the board [20][21] Group 3: CEO Performance Evaluation and Incentives - The Board of Directors is responsible for organizing the performance evaluation of the CEO [32] - The CEO's compensation is linked to company performance and individual achievements [33] - In cases of misconduct or negligence leading to company losses, the CEO may face economic penalties or legal consequences [35]
